             I just replaced my generator and regulator when the car is running at 600 rpm or less the generator light will come on dim. What would be the next thing to check ?

Bruce,

One can always put a meter on the VR to see if it charges correctly. On my 1956 and 1953, in gear at idle, when hot, the light is dim or flickers - and both Voltage Regulators are set correctly. The cars charge as they are supposed to. One does not get a lot of output from a generator at idle.

Agreed, all the generator equipped cars I had or worked on do the same thing, at idle there is no amp output, either 6 or 12v, that is why alternators were introduced.
